Do you enjoy a diverse and challenging work environment? Bring your results oriented leadership and technical skills, relationship-building talents and business services acumen to this interesting, client-focused position within the Ministry of Transportation's Business Services Office.

What can I expect to do in this role?

In this role, your work will include:
• Supervising and providing leadership to staff engaged in various business support services
• Coordinating I&IT and providing technical leadership and recommendations
• Providing policy, procedural and business planning advice and analysis
• Recommending effective quality services options and resolving complex issues
• Planning, supervising and coordinating business and administrative services
• Developing, recommending and implementing service delivery processes, ensuring that service levels are met and work plans and priorities are delivered
• Coordinating the regional training & development program and the regional staffing plan
• Conducting facility-related initiatives, including emergency preparedness and building security
• Preparing and managing budgets and expenditures
• Monitoring regional service agreements, ensuring standards are met
• Leading projects and providing advice to management on interpretation and application of government processes and procedures

All external applicants (including former employees of the Ontario Public Service) applying to a competition in a ministry or Commission public body must disclose (either in the cover letter or resume) previous employment with the Ontario Public Service. Disclosure must include positions held, dates of employment and any active restrictions as applicable from being rehired by the Ontario Public Service. Active restrictions can include time and/or ministry-specific restrictions currently in force, and may preclude a former employee from being offered a position with the Ontario Public Service for a specific time period (e.g. one year), or from being offered a position with a specific ministry (either for a pre-determined time period or indefinitely). The circumstances around an employee's exit will be considered prior to an offer of employment.
